304210466 is an even composite number. It is composed of six dist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of sixty-four divisors.
Prime factorization of 304210466:
2 × 7 × 23 × 43 × 127 × 173

- Sum of all divisors σ(n): 564461568
- Sum of proper divisors (its aliquot sum) s(n): 260251102
- 304210466 is a deficient number, because the sum of its proper divisors (260251102) is less than itself. Its deficiency is 43959364
